Governance Ministry of Science develops 'anti-counterfeiting ink', says will tackle duplication of money
Developed through a straightforward co-precipitation process at 120°C, the nanomaterials were blended into commercially available PVC ink via sonication, ensuring even distribution of nanoparticles.
